Output 21a51869b2e4ad937bc409cea4ded0d0fc16f0bd0844951b97f7f83325dff68b:2

value
28754
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de9d814918cc3cab1db32d426a0021a88416b1f521cc62977c72c8422cb73b7f
address
bc1pm6wczjgces72k8dn94px5qpp4zzpdv04y8xx99muwtyyyt9h8dls2jk943
transaction
21a51869b2e4ad937bc409cea4ded0d0fc16f0bd0844951b97f7f83325dff68b
confirmations
96
spent
true